Types of Glass Patio Doors


Picking the right type of glass patio door is critical to both functionality and style. Here are some typical types:

  1. Sliding Glass Doors:

    • Slide open up to conserve space.
    • Offered in numerous materials such as vinyl, aluminum, and wood-clad.
  2. French Doors:

    • Swing open, providing a conventional and classy appearance.
    • Offered in numerous styles, including full glass and divided-light options.
  3. Folding Glass Doors:

    • Also understood as bi-fold doors, they fold to the side, developing a broad entranceway.
    • Perfect for large areas and modern visual appeals.
  4. Multi-Slide Doors:

    • Operate on several tracks and can open up a large wall to the exterior.
    • Excellent for contemporary homes that highlight indoor-outdoor living.

1. Product Selection

The material of your brand-new patio doors will substantially influence their sturdiness, look, and upkeep requirements. Here is a comparison table of common materials:

Material

Pros

Cons

Vinyl

Energy-efficient, low maintenance, budget friendly

Minimal color alternatives

Aluminum

Strong, light-weight, and contemporary aesthetic

Poor insulation

Wood

Appealing, natural finish, excellent insulation

Needs routine upkeep

Fiberglass

Highly resilient, energy-efficient, mimics wood appearance

Higher preliminary expense

4. Cost Considerations

The expense of changing glass patio doors can differ extensively based on product, style, and installation intricacy. Below is a breakdown of typical expenses:

Type of Door

Average Cost (consisting of setup)

Sliding Glass Door

₤ 1,200 – ₤ 3,500

French Doors

₤ 1,500 – ₤ 4,000

Folding Doors

₤ 3,000 – ₤ 10,000

Multi-Slide Doors

₤ 5,000 – ₤ 15,000

Installation Process


Changing glass patio doors generally involves the following actions:

  1. Remove the Old Door: Carefully separate the old door and any trim or framing.
  2. Prepare the Opening: Inspect and repair the door frame if necessary.
  3. Install the New Door: Follow the producer's instructions to make sure appropriate setup.
  4. Seal and Insulate: Apply weather removing and sealant to ensure energy performance.
  5. Set up Trim: Replace or install new trim around the door for a completed look.

Frequently Asked Questions


Q: How do I understand if my patio door requires replacement?

A: Signs include visible damage (fractures, warping), drafts, problem opening or closing, and high energy expenses.

Q: Can I change my patio door myself?

A: While it's possible for DIY enthusiasts to change a patio door, it's often much better to hire professionals for appropriate installation and to avoid pricey errors.

Q: How long does it require to change a patio door?

A: The replacement process generally takes a couple of hours to a complete day, depending on the intricacy of the setup and whether any structural repairs are needed.

Q: What is the typical life-span of a glass patio door?

A: With correct maintenance, glass patio doors can last in between 15 to 30 years, depending upon the materials and environment conditions.

Q: Are there any service warranties used on new patio doors?

A: Most producers provide warranties on their doors, normally covering glass, frame, and hardware. Always inspect the specifics before purchase.
